J. Anthony (Tony) Poleo
Department of Defense

J. Anthony Poleo was appointed by President George W. Bush to the Committee for Purchase From People Who Are Blind or Severely Disabled (Committee) in February 2007, representing the Department of Defense.

On January 4, 2007, Tony Poleo was selected to be the Chief Financial Officer (CFO) of the Defense Logistics Agency.

The Defense Logistics Agency, headquartered at Fort Belvoir, Virginia, is responsible for providing the Army, Navy, Air Force, Marine Corps, and other Federal agencies with a variety of logistics, acquisition and technical services in peace and war. These services include logistics information, materiel management, procurement, warehousing and distribution of spare parts, food, clothing, medical supplies and fuel, reutilization of surplus military materiel and document automation and production. This worldwide mission is performed by approximately 21,300 civilian and military personnel with an annual budget of approximately $35 billion.

Poleo began his DLA career as an undergraduate cooperative education student in 1981, and returned full-time to the DLA Financial Operations Directorate upon graduation in 1984. From 1984 to 2001, he held various and progressively more responsible positions in the DLA Financial Operations Directorate. In 1986, he interned as the Defense legislative aide to Senator J. Bennett Johnston, United States Senate.

From 2001 to his selection as CFO, Poleo served as the Principal Deputy Comptroller, DLA Directorate of Financial Operations.

Poleo received his B.S. in Business (Finance) degree from Virginia Tech in 1984. In 1989, he earned a Masters Degree in Public Financial Management from American University. He holds Defense Financial Management and Government Financial Management certifications. Poleo has also completed the Program for Senior Executive Fellows at Harvard University and the Leadership for a Democratic Society program at the Federal Executive Institute.
